- The distance between Rhodes, Greece and Bulawayo Goetz, Zimbabwe is approximately 6,288 km or 3,908 mi.
- To reach Rhodes in this distance one would set out from Bulawayo Goetz bearing 359.5°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Rhodes bearing 359.4° or N .
- Rhodes has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Bulawayo Goetz has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
- The average annual temperature is 0.1 °C (0.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.1 °C (12.8°F) more in Rhodes.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 111.3 mm (4.4 in) more which is equivalent to 111.3 l/m² (2.73 US gal/ft²) or 1,113,000 l/ha (118,987 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 14.5° lower in Rhodes than in Bulawayo Goetz.
